Filmstrip Projector A filmstrip is one of the projective audio visual that a fixed sequence related still on a roll of 35 mm film. Filmstrip is a continuous strip of 35 mm or 16mm or 8mm film consisting of individual frames or pictures arranged in sequence, usually with exploratory titles.Click to see full answer.
